Prior to beginning SABRIL, tell your doctor regarding every one of your (or your youngster's) clinical problems including anxiety, mood troubles, self-destructive thoughts vigabatrin skin side effects or actions, any allergic reaction to SABRIL, vision troubles, kidney troubles, reduced red cell counts (anemia), and any type of mental or nervous ailment.

SABRIL (vigabatrin) is a prescription medicine used with various other therapies in children and adults 2 years old and older with refractory complex partial seizures (CPS) that have not responded all right to a number of other treatments and if the possible benefits surpass the risk of vision loss.

It is recommended that your doctor examination your (or your kid's) vision prior to or within 4 weeks after starting SABRIL and at least every 3 months throughout therapy up until SABRIL is quit. If you or your kid have any side result that bothers you or that does not go away, tell your medical care supplier.

If you are expecting or plan to obtain expectant, inform your health care provider. If vision testing can not be done, your healthcare provider may proceed recommending SABRIL, however will not be able to look for any vision loss. Your healthcare company may stop recommending SABRIL for you (or your youngster)if vision tests are not done routinely.
